    This song has always been important to David Gilmour, in fact it may be his favorite Pink Floyd song of all time. Because it truly was the transition of Pink Floyd from an experimental psycho rock band to the very serious mature sound that came after with Dark Side, Wish you were, Animals, and the Wall. This single song was that pivotal.
